GRADES 3 - 5 FLOATY RELAY: Swimmers wearing flotation devices swim 25 yards. Swimmers must touch the wall before the next swimmer can start (Flotation devices must be supplied by swimmer) DOGGY PADDLE RELAY: Swimmers each swim a 25 yard doggy paddle PUMPKIN PUSH RELAY: Swimmers use a kick board to transport a pumpkin to the end of the pool and hand off to the next swimmer. GRADES 6 - 8 Superhero Relay – see description to the right Pumpkin Hug Relay – Swimmers use a kickboard to transport a pumpkin to the end of the pool and hand off to the next swimmer Grade Level Relay – See description on right Individual Medley – swimmer does 25 yards of each stroke (Fly, Back, Breast, Free) T-Shirt Relay – see description to the right Hand Flipper 50 – swim 2 lengths with flippers on hands, stroke is swimmers choice Duck Balance Backstroke – must keep a rubber duck balanced on swimmers forehead while completing 50 backstroke GRADES 9-12/ADULT Relays (4 Per Team) Tag Team Relay – 2 swimmers each swim a 50 twice. They must dive from the block each time Salmon Run Relay – Sprint 25 yards and complete 10 pushups before the next swimmer can enter the water Spud Fist Freestyle Relay – Swim with potato held in hands while swimming 50 Freestyle Parent Relay – Parents swim against each other GRADES 9 - 12/ADULT Individual/Pair Events Lungbuster – swim farthest in one breath One-Arm Bandit – 50 swim with 1 arm Hand Flipper 50 – swim 2 lengths with flippers on hands stroke is swimmers choice Corkscrew 50 – switch between free/back Superhero Relay – Students swim 25 yards each wearing a cape around their chest Tennis Ball Breaststroke – must keep ball underneath the swimmer’s chin Pumpkin Hug Relay – Swim 25 yards while keeping a pumpkin submerged under water Duck Balance Backstroke – must keep rubber duck balanced on forehead for a 50 Grade Level Relay – Students from the same grade compete against each other and/or Students from the same school compete against one another in teams based on grade level 50 Butterfly – swim butterfly for 2 lengths T-Shirt Relay – Sprint 25 in a very large t-shirt. The next swimmer must put on the same t-shirt before entering the water Alumni Relay – former swim team members compete against other alumni Butterfly Relay – all relay team members swim 50 yards of the Butterfly stroke Three-Legged Race – two swimmers connected by a pair of tights swim 50 yards Deadweight 50 – swimmers carry another swimmer who is not allowed to kick, once they reach 25 yards, the swimmers switch who the deadweight is Potato Sack Race – 25 yard hop along the bottom of the pool with legs in a potato sack
